FY2026 School Finance Fiscal Operations Updates

FY2026 School Finance Fiscal Operations Updates

Base Level Amount 15-901

2.00%/$100.26 total increase

  • $5,113.26

Transportation Support Level 15-945

2.07% increase to support per route mile

  • 0.5 or fewer: $3.01
  • 0.5-1.0: $2.47
  • More than 1.0: $3.01

District Additional Assistance (DAA) & Charter Additional Assistance (CAA) 15-185 & 15-961

2.00% increase to CAA

  • Grades PSD-8: $2,131.90
  • Grades 9-12: $2,484.69

Qualifying Tax Rate 41-1276

Unified School Districts and Common School Districts not within a High School District (Type 03): $3.1212

Common School Districts within High School District and High School Districts: $1.5606

State Aid Rollover 15-973

$800,727,700 of the FY 2026 basic state aid appropriation to school districts is deferred until July 2026.

This is equal to FY 2025.

Does not apply to charters or school districts with less than 4,000 ADM.

Classroom Site Fund 15-977

$842 per weighted pupil

($50 Increase)

State Aid Supplement

One-time supplemental proportional funding for School Districts and Charter Districts based on weighted student counts. The additional amount received by each charter and district will increase budget capacity; districts can use their apportionment in either Maintenance & Operation or Unrestricted Capital Outlay funds.

  • $75,000,000

One Time Supplement for CAA & DAA

One-time supplemental funding for Charter Additional Assistance (CAA) and District Additional Assistance (DAA) will be allocated on a proportional basis. The additional amount received by each charter and district will increase budget capacity; districts can use their apportionment in either Maintenance & Operation or Unrestricted Capital Outlay funds.

  • CAA statewide amount: $5,858,000
  • DAA statewide amount: $23,142,000

One Time Supplement for FRPL

One-time supplemental funding for Free and Reduced Priced Lunch (FRPL) will be allocated on a pro rata basis using FRPL weighted ADM. The amount apportioned to each charter and district will increase budget capacity; districts can use their apportionment in either Maintenance & Operation or Unrestricted Capital Outlay funds.

  • FRPL statewide amount: $37,000,000.00

FY 2025 Prop 123 Payment 2

FY 2025 Prop 123 Payment 2

The $75 million additional funding provided by Proposition 123 (Laws 2015, 1st Special Session, Chapter 1) for FY 2025 will be distributed in two payments: $37.5 million on December 6, 2024, and $37.5 million by June 30, 2025. Individual school district and charter allocations are based on the share of statewide weighted Average Daily Membership (ADM). The second $37.5 million payment was calculated based on the same ADM that was used for the FY25 June Classroom Site Fund payment. 

The file linked below will show the first, second, and total annual payment amounts for the FY 2025 Prop 123 payment per LEA. Districts are listed first by county, followed by charters alphabetically.

Budget Forms for the Upcoming Fiscal Year

Budget Forms for the Upcoming Fiscal Year

Budget forms for the upcoming fiscal year are typically published shortly after the State budget passes to incorporate any changes in State law. Since the FY 2026 State budget has not yet passed, School Finance and the Auditor General's Office are planning to publish preliminary budget forms to allow districts and charters to plan budget preparation processes and governing board meetings.

The Auditor General's Office expects to publish preliminary budget forms for use in budget proposal and adoption by Thursday, May 22nd if the State budget has not passed and does not appear likely to pass the following week. Please note that preliminary budget forms will not account for routine annual changes, such as inflation, and will not anticipate any other changes to State law. Therefore, any district or charter that proposes its budget using the preliminary budget forms must also adopt the preliminary forms, then revise its budget in early FY 2026 using the final budget forms to incorporate any changes in State law. Districts in which the qualifying levy is greater than the equalization base (non-State-aid districts), in particular, should be aware of the impact of preliminary forms on the budget and discuss property tax rate considerations with counties if preliminary budget forms are used with revisions expected. We will provide a timeframe for final budget form issuance once final changes in State law are known.

If the State budget passes before May 22nd, or appears likely to pass the following week, the Auditor General’s Office will not publish preliminary forms and will instead publish the final budget forms as soon as possible after the budget passes. The final forms will account for all changes in State law, and it may not be necessary to revise the budget in early FY 2026.
